Steps to Schedule a Post on WordPress

Follow these steps to schedule your post:

Step 1: Write Your Post

First, write your post. Log in to your WordPress dashboard. Click on “Posts” and then “Add New.” Write your post as you normally would. Add your title, content, images, and links.

Step 2: Open The Publish Settings

Once your post is ready, look at the “Publish” box on the right side. This box shows the status of your post. By default, it says “Publish immediately.”

Step 3: Choose A Date And Time

Click on “Edit” next to “Publish immediately.” You will see options to change the date and time. Pick the date and time you want your post to publish. Make sure to set the time correctly.

Step 4: Save Your Changes

After setting the date and time, click “OK.” The “Publish” button will change to “Schedule.” Click “Schedule” to save your changes. Your post is now scheduled.

Step 5: Confirm Your Scheduled Post

To confirm your post is scheduled, go to “Posts” and then “All Posts.” You will see your post listed with the word “Scheduled” next to it. This means it is set to publish on the date and time you chose.

Common Questions

Here are answers to some common questions about scheduling posts:

Can I Edit A Scheduled Post?

Yes, you can edit a scheduled post. Go to “Posts” and then “All Posts.” Find your scheduled post and click “Edit.” Make your changes and click “Update.”

Can I Change The Schedule Date?

Yes, you can change the schedule date. Open the post you want to reschedule. Change the date and time in the “Publish” box. Click “Update” to save your changes.
